Forcing bulbs is a time-honored horticultural technique that tricks dormant bulbs into blooming weeks or even months ahead of their natural schedule. This process mimics the prolonged cold and damp conditions of winter, signaling to the bulb that spring has arrived and it is time to initiate growth. By manipulating these environmental cues, gardeners can enjoy vibrant tulips, daffodils, and hyacinths inside the home, long before the last frost has passed outdoors.

At the core of bulb forcing is the concept of vernalization, a biological requirement for a period of cold temperatures. Most hardy spring-flowering bulbs originate from regions with harsh winters and require this prolonged chill to break dormancy. When you place a bulb in a dark, cool environment—typically between 35°F and 48°F (1.5°C and 9°C)—it undergoes internal chemical changes. The bulb conserves energy by slowly developing roots and a pre-formed flower spike, waiting for the warmth and light to finally emerge.

Not all bulbs are suitable for forcing, and selecting the correct varieties is the first step toward a successful display. Species that are naturally vigorous and prolific are the best candidates. Look for firm, healthy bulbs that are large and heavy for their size, avoiding any that are soft, moldy, or showing signs of rot. Popular choices include hyacinths, which are the easiest to force and provide an intense fragrance, and paperwhite narcissus, which are renowned for their speed and ability to bloom without chilling.

Tulips: Select species tulips or smaller Darwin hybrids, as they tend to perform better than large, tall varieties.

Daffodils: Look for small-cupped or jonquilla types, such as 'Tete-a-Tete', which are highly reliable for indoor cultivation.

Hyacinths: Opt for prepared bulbs specifically labeled for forcing, as they are pre-treated to bloom predictably.

Crocus: These early bloomers are excellent for adding delicate color and are often very affordable.

Gardeners can employ several methods to coax bulbs into flowering, each offering a unique experience and aesthetic. The choice of method often depends on the type of bulb and the desired visual effect. The most traditional approach involves soil, which provides stability and a natural growing medium, while water-based methods offer a modern, minimalist look.

Soil Forcing

Planting bulbs in a high-quality, well-draining potting mix is the most traditional method. This technique allows for the development of a strong root system and provides the support needed for top-heavy blooms. A container with drainage holes is essential to prevent rot. The bulbs are placed close together, with their tips just below the soil surface, and then watered thoroughly before the chilling period begins.

Water Forcing

The water or gravel method is a popular choice for hyacinths and paperwhite narcissus, requiring no soil. Bulbs are positioned so that their bases are in contact with water, while the bulbs themselves remain dry to prevent rotting. This method is particularly satisfying because it allows you to watch the roots develop rapidly in the clear water. Support is often provided by specialized forcing jars or simple containers filled with pebbles that hold the bulb in place.
